Changing Units in the Customary System

Strategy When converting from a large unit to a small unit, multiply by the conversion factor.

When converting from a small unit to a larger unit, divide by the conversion factor.

Small - - - - - - - - LargeInch (in) ---------- Foot (ft)-------- Yard (yd) ------- Mile (mi)

Ounce (oz) -------------- Pound (lb) -------------Ton (t)

Fluid Ounce (fl. oz.) -- Cup (c) -- Pint (pt) -- Quart (qt) -- Gallon (gal)

Changing Units Determine the direction of the change (LS or SL)

Multiply or Divide by the appropriate conversion unit.

Example12 gal = ______ qt

Example 4 Comparing Convert to the same units then compare.

18 ft ______ 220 in

Convert: 18 x 12 = 216 in

Or Convert 220 ÷ 12 = 18.3 ft

18 ft ___<___ 220 in
